What Is Artificial Intelligence (AI)?

The idea of “a maker that believes” dates back to ancient Greece. But since the introduction of electronic computing (and relative to some of the topics discussed in this short article) important events and milestones in the development of AI include the following:

1950.
Alan Turing publishes Computing Machinery and Intelligence. In this paper, Turing-famous for breaking the German ENIGMA code during WWII and often described as the “daddy of computer technology”- asks the following concern: “Can makers believe?”

From there, he uses a test, now notoriously referred to as the “Turing Test,” where a human interrogator would try to compare a computer and human text action. While this test has actually undergone much scrutiny because it was released, it stays a vital part of the history of AI, and a continuous principle within philosophy as it utilizes concepts around linguistics.

1956.
John McCarthy coins the term “expert system” at the first-ever AI conference at Dartmouth College. (McCarthy went on to create the Lisp language.) Later that year, Allen Newell, J.C. Shaw and Herbert Simon develop the Logic Theorist, the first-ever running AI computer system program.

1967.
Frank Rosenblatt constructs the Mark 1 Perceptron, the first computer system based upon a neural network that “found out” through experimentation. Just a year later, Marvin Minsky and Seymour Papert release a book titled Perceptrons, which ends up being both the landmark work on neural networks and, a minimum of for a while, an argument versus future neural network research study efforts.

1980.
Neural networks, which use a backpropagation algorithm to train itself, became extensively used in AI applications.

1995.
Stuart Russell and Peter Norvig publish Expert system: A Modern Approach, which turns into one of the leading books in the research study of AI. In it, they dig into four possible goals or definitions of AI, which differentiates computer systems based upon rationality and thinking versus acting.

1997.
IBM’s Deep Blue beats then world chess champion Garry Kasparov, in a chess match (and rematch).

2004.
John McCarthy composes a paper, What Is Artificial Intelligence?, and proposes an often-cited meaning of AI. By this time, the period of big information and is underway, allowing companies to manage ever-larger information estates, which will one day be utilized to train AI designs.

2011.
IBM Watson ® beats champs Ken Jennings and Brad Rutter at Jeopardy! Also, around this time, data science begins to become a popular discipline.

2015.
Baidu’s Minwa supercomputer uses an unique deep neural network called a convolutional neural network to identify and classify images with a greater rate of precision than the typical human.

2016.
DeepMind’s AlphaGo program, powered by a deep neural network, beats Lee Sodol, the world champ Go player, in a five-game match. The victory is substantial provided the big variety of possible relocations as the video game advances (over 14.5 trillion after just four moves). Later, Google acquired DeepMind for a reported USD 400 million.

2022.
An increase in large language designs or LLMs, such as OpenAI’s ChatGPT, creates a huge modification in efficiency of AI and its possible to drive enterprise value. With these new generative AI practices, deep-learning designs can be pretrained on large quantities of data.

2024.
The newest AI trends point to a continuing AI renaissance. Multimodal designs that can take multiple types of information as input are providing richer, more robust experiences. These models bring together computer vision image recognition and NLP speech acknowledgment abilities. Smaller models are likewise making strides in an age of reducing returns with massive models with large specification counts.
